Hi, I've just been given an old pc. I think they recently had a problem with it & gave up. I've no idea if the problem relates to a recent change in software, a virus or what. I'm not even sure what the pc has yet, as I can't get it to boot up. (not too familiar with dos or safe mode)
I start it up, shortly after I get this message ..

"Cannot find device file that may be needed to run Windows or a Windows application. The Windows registry or SYSTEM.INI file refers to this device but the device file no longer exists. If you still want to use the application associated with that file, try re-installing the application"(followed by) "C:\PROGRA~1\NORTON~1\NAVAP.VXD"

Then, I get to the wallpaper, cancel the (win98, I think) password and immediately get an illegal operation message ..
(details) "Explorer caused an invalid page fault in module EXPLORER.EXE at 0177:00401f31" & I have to close down.

I have done some looking around & see a few posts with this very problem. I have tried what worked for someone, to restore to a previous date, while it successfully restored, I got the same thing after rebooting.

I see a bit of conflicting advice .. does anyone know what this might mean & if I can try sorting it in perhaps safe mode (as I can not get into windows). I don't mind getting rid of Norton, as I wouldn't be using it anyway. Maybe I need to just get rid of this device file, or look for a virus?? ..any info greatly appreciated!
 
I would suggest you to boot the safe mode... go to the registry editor and find and remove "C:\PROGRA~1\NORTON~1\NAVAP.VXD" and then run a msconfig - try to clean boot the system... it should work...
If you don't care for whts in there... u can definately opt to reinstall the os
